Scope
This part of GB/T 18978 briefly introduces the content of other parts in the "300" sub-series of GB/T 18978 and explains the modular structure of this sub-series of standards. The GB/T 18978 "300" sub-series of standards defines the ergonomic design requirements for electronic visual displays. These requirements, as performance specifications for electronic visual displays, aim to ensure that users with normal or corrected vision have an effective and comfortable visual condition, and provide test methods and measurement methods that comply with consistency measurements and guidelines for design evaluation.
The GB/T 18978 "300" sub-series of standards are applicable to the visual ergonomic design of electronic visual displays in various work environments and under various work tasks.
